class documentation

class MiddlewareMixin:

Known subclasses: django.contrib.auth.middleware.AuthenticationMiddleware, django.contrib.auth.middleware.RemoteUserMiddleware, django.contrib.flatpages.middleware.FlatpageFallbackMiddleware, django.contrib.messages.middleware.MessageMiddleware, django.contrib.redirects.middleware.RedirectFallbackMiddleware, django.contrib.sessions.middleware.SessionMiddleware, django.contrib.sites.middleware.CurrentSiteMiddleware, django.middleware.cache.FetchFromCacheMiddleware, django.middleware.cache.UpdateCacheMiddleware, django.middleware.clickjacking.XFrameOptionsMiddleware, django.middleware.common.BrokenLinkEmailsMiddleware, django.middleware.common.CommonMiddleware, django.middleware.csrf.CsrfViewMiddleware, django.middleware.gzip.GZipMiddleware, django.middleware.http.ConditionalGetMiddleware, django.middleware.locale.LocaleMiddleware, django.middleware.security.SecurityMiddleware, django.contrib.admin.tests.CSPMiddleware, django.contrib.admindocs.middleware.XViewMiddleware

View In Hierarchy

Undocumented

Async Method __acall__ Async version of __call__ that is swapped in when an async request is running.
Method __call__ Undocumented
Method __init__ Undocumented
Method __repr__ Undocumented
Method ​_async​_check If get_response is a coroutine function, turns us into async mode so a thread is not consumed during a whole request.
Class Variable async​_capable Undocumented
Class Variable sync​_capable Undocumented
Instance Variable ​_is​_coroutine Undocumented
Instance Variable get​_response Undocumented
async def __acall__(self, request):
Async version of __call__ that is swapped in when an async request is running.
def __call__(self, request):

Undocumented

def __repr__(self):

Undocumented

def _async_check(self):
If get_response is a coroutine function, turns us into async mode so a thread is not consumed during a whole request.
async_capable: bool =

Undocumented

sync_capable: bool =

Undocumented

_is_coroutine =

Undocumented

get_response =

Undocumented